AI-Powered Innovations Unveiled

The Las Vegas Technology Convention 2025 was a hotspot for AI enthusiasts, with a showcase of remarkable AI-powered innovations. Companies like Intel and NVIDIA were in the spotlight with their next-gen processors and chips designed to enhance AI capabilities. Intel's new AI processors promise to boost computational efficiency, making real-time insights more accessible. Meanwhile, NVIDIA's GB10 Superchip was a showstopper, offering unprecedented processing speeds and energy efficiency, setting a new standard for AI applications across various sectors.

Quantum Error Correction

Quantum error correction is like the unsung hero of quantum computing. It's all about fixing mistakes that happen in quantum bits, or qubits. These errors can be a real headache because qubits are super sensitive. Imagine trying to balance a pencil on its tip—any tiny nudge and it falls. That's how touchy qubits can be. So, scientists are working hard to make them more stable. This stability is crucial for quantum computers to become reliable enough for everyday use. Companies like Google's new quantum chip, "Willow," are making strides in this area, aiming to keep those qubits in check.

Advancements in Machine Perception

Machine perception is about teaching computers to interpret the world as humans do. This field has seen significant progress, especially in areas like computer vision and natural language processing. Computers can now recognize objects in images, understand spoken language, and even generate realistic human-like text.

  • Computer Vision: Enables machines to "see" and process visual information, which is crucial for applications like autonomous vehicles and facial recognition.
  • Natural Language Processing: Allows computers to understand and respond to human language, powering chatbots and virtual assistants.
  • Audio Processing: Involves analyzing and interpreting sound data, which is key for voice-activated devices.
